Skip to main content

Python Glacier Evolution Model for large-scale glacier modeling

Project description

Python Glacier Evolution Model (PyGEM)

Overview: Python Glacier Evolution Model (PyGEM) is an open-source glacier evolution model coded in Python that models the transient evolution of glaciers. Each glacier is modeled independently using a monthly timestep. PyGEM has a modular framework that allows different schemes to be used for model calibration or model physics (e.g., climatic mass balance, glacier dynamics). In the newest version under development, PyGEM is working to become compatible with the Open Global Glacier Model (OGGM; https://oggm.org/).

Manual: Details concerning the model physics, installation, and running the model may be found here: https://github.com/drounce/PyGEM/wiki

Usage: PyGEM is meant for large-scale glacier evolution modeling. PyGEMv0.2.0 is no longer being actively being supported. We recommend using the new documentation listed above and contacting the lead developer (David Rounce) if you're interested in using the version that is actively being developed.

Contributing: We welcome contributions from any interested parties and are in the process of outlining how to best incorporate outside contributions. For the time being, if you would like to contribute to the development of the model, please contact David Rounce (drounce@cmu.edu).

Credits: If using PyGEM for scientific applications, please cite the following: Rounce, D.R., Hock, R., Maussion, F., Hugonnet, R., Kochtitzky, W., Huss, M., Berthier, E., Brinkerhoff, D., Compagno, L., Copland, L., Farinotti, D., Menounos, B., and McNabb, R.W. “Global glacier change in the 21st century: Every increase in temperature matters”, Science, 379(6627), pp. 78-83, (2023), doi:10.1126/science.abo1324.

License: PyGEM uses an MIT license.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

pygem-0.3.0.tar.gz (733.6 kB view details)

Uploaded Source

Built Distribution

pygem-0.3.0-py2.py3-none-any.whl (72.1 kB view details)

Uploaded Python 2 Python 3

File details

Details for the file pygem-0.3.0.tar.gz.

File metadata

  • Download URL: pygem-0.3.0.tar.gz
  • Upload date:
  • Size: 733.6 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/5.1.1 CPython/3.12.4

File hashes

Hashes for pygem-0.3.0.tar.gz
Algorithm Hash digest
SHA256 cc267ed662ce4b54f4b237c58dae7ab98c9697b0bdeabe9d1e57a1724b33917d
MD5 fc90713b9c0931f4b8940fcd8b8fb96c
BLAKE2b-256 18cce66f9e09eb204c8c3455f70037d1972d76d5404039e8b4769eb029d07305

See more details on using hashes here.

File details

Details for the file pygem-0.3.0-py2.py3-none-any.whl.

File metadata

  • Download URL: pygem-0.3.0-py2.py3-none-any.whl
  • Upload date:
  • Size: 72.1 kB
  • Tags: Python 2,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/5.1.1 CPython/3.12.4

File hashes

Hashes for pygem-0.3.0-py2.py3-none-any.whl
Algorithm Hash digest
SHA256 ac604a243bec8a889646936c6d697f099acf622e74fd1e33589e42ccea81009c
MD5 61d87ffcfd525e8e72f12dc346125a8b
BLAKE2b-256 54b4eaa5b0e51aa28ece584bbb6e35241436cc9abc51bbfefb0c0012cd43513c

See more details on using hashes here.

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page